Background technique
Nopinene is also known as β-turpentine alkene, bicyclic diterpene class compound, is oil with australene double-bond positional isomerization body each other Shape is one of turpentine oil main component, can be used for the allotment of daily chemical essence and for other industrial goods flavorings, is mainly used for various terpenes The starting material of alkenes synthetic perfume, for manufacturing citral, citronellol, laurine, geraniol, linalool, violet The synthetic perfumes such as ketone, methylionone, menthol, but also be the important original closed nopinene resin and produce vitamin E etc. One of material.The structural formula of nopinene is as follows:
In agricultural production due to long-term, single use or abuse desinsection/microbial inoculum, make pest or disease to desinsection/microbial inoculum Produce drug resistance, or even development is cross resistance and multiresistance, at the same a large amount of uses of herbicide easily cause phytotoxicity or Drift or even resistance rise.It is complicated to develop synthesis new varieties of pesticides technology process, appointed condition requires high, registration It is cumbersome, hinder the development of agricultural production.The generation of harmful organism drug resistance mainly selects to press due to medicament to harmful organism Power as a result, this selection pressure again mainly as single dose it is single to controlling object position or less caused by.Therefore, it selects There are two or more composite reagents of synergistic effect, is the key of solving the problem.
Synergist refers to a kind of chemical substance of no to insect or few insecticidal properties, but makes an addition to a certain kill After worm/microbial inoculum or herbicide, the insecticidal power of desinsection/microbial inoculum or herbicide can be greatly improved.The advantages of adding synergist exists In, insecticidal effect can be greatly increased, insecticide dosage is reduced, to reduce cost, reduces the content of insecticide in human environment, Pest resistance to insecticide can be reduced over a period to come, and can economically control pest.Inventor is after study It was found that nopinene has good synergistic effect to pesticide, currently without the research report about nopinene as pesticide synergistic agent Road.

One, test and method
Using slide infusion process evaluation nopinene and other acaricides to citrus Tetranychus cinnabarinus and panonychus citri, with minimum Square law calculates virulence equation and lethal concentration of 50 LC50, toxicity index and mixed co-toxicity coefficient according to Sun Yunpei calculating medicament (CTC value).
According to Sun Yunpei's Method, the synergistic effect of pharmacy mix is evaluated according to co-toxicity coefficient (CTC), i.e. CTC≤80 are association Same antagonism, 80 < CTC < 120 are joint action of antagonism, and CTC >=120 are synergistic function.Survey toxicity index (ATI)=(LC50 of the LC50/ reagent agent of standard agent) × 100;
The virulence of the percentage composition+B medicament of A medicament refers in toxicity index × mixture of theoretical toxicity index TTI=A medicament The percentage composition of B medicament in number × mixture;
Co-toxicity coefficient (CTC)=[mixture surveys toxicity index (ATI)/mixtures theoretical toxicity index (TTI)] × 100.
